The former football star walked out of a nevada prison early this morning after serving nine years for armed robbery. In 2007, simpson and a group of men stormed the Las Vegas Hotel room of the Sports Memorabilia dealer and stole hundreds of items. Simpson said he was just reclaiming his own property. For that conviction, he served a minimum sentence. No word yet on where he is going. But to leave nevada, more paperwork has to be done. Simpson said his first meal will be the in and out burger. Right now, millions in puerto rico are still without electricity. 11 days after Hurricane Maria tour through the island. Many are short of cash, gasoline and clean drinking water. President trump lashed out at the leaders of the island yesterday with a storm he said such poor leadership by the mayor of san juan and others in puerto rico who cannot get the workers help he then added they want everything to be done for them. Actually, i was asking for help. I was not saying anything nasty about the president. The president of the United States can make sure someone is in charge. And another tweet, the president blamed partisan politics claiming that the mayor was criticizing the president on orders from democrats. Meanwhile, bay area residents came together to help devastated victims in puerto rico. They gather last night at the midnight sun in San Francisco. Organizers say they put politics aside and only wanted to help fellow americans in need. We want to focus on helping another country. The president can say whatever he wants to say. Mr. Trump plans to go to puerto rico tuesday to assess the damage firsthand. Weather on the minds of people in san jose where some neighborhoods are still recovering after the february massive flood for thousands of people getting forced out of their homes. The Water District organized a cleanup yesterday. Hundreds of volunteers along coyote creek removing trash and debris clogging are waterway. The Water District is working on a plan to reduce the risk of flooding in the future. There is no way we can say we can absolutely guarantee this area will never flood again. It has been flooding for decades. What we can do is minimize the impact. Some residents have only recently been allowed to go home , seven months after being evacuated.
